Rural Infrastructure
Overview: SEBAC-Nepal focuses on design, construction, and feasibility assessment of essential rural infrastructure to improve connectivity, access to services and enhance livelihood in remote communities. SEBAC-Nepal believes that comprehensive approach to rural infrastructure development play a significant role in fostering economic growth, community resilience and sustainable development in rural area.
The interventions contribute to multiple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), with a strong focus on infrastructure development, poverty reduction, and improving access to essential services. The construction of 400 irrigation schemes enhances agricultural productivity for 1 million people, aligning with SDG 2 (Zero Hunger). Housing projects and healthcare facilities improve living conditions and access to essential services, supporting SDG 1 (No Poverty) and SDG 3 (Good Health and Well-being). The development of 1,615 trail bridges, 1,242 km of rural roads, and 536 km of foot trails strengthens connectivity and economic opportunities, supporting SDG 9 (Industry, Innovation, and Infrastructure) and SDG 10 (Reduced Inequalities). The 12 school buildings constructed has enhanced educational access, aligning with SDG 4 (Quality Education). These interventions also contribute to SDG 11 (Sustainable Cities and Communities) by improving infrastructure and promoting sustainable rural development, while SDG 13 (Climate Action) is supported through resilient irrigation systems.
SEBAC-Nepal has completed 13 projects improving rural connectivity and accessibility through construction & technical assistance for rural infrastructures.
Areas of Expertise
✅Feasibility study, survey, design, estimate and preparation of detailed project reports;
✅Design and construction of short span trail bridges up to 120m and long span trail bridges of over 120m; and other rural infrastructures such as WASH structures, irrigation canals, irrigation ponds, rural roads, foot trails, gravity ropeways, and community, individual, school and health post buildings, etc.
✅ Construction of disaster resilient infrastructures
Key Interventions and Achievements of SEBAC-Nepal
✅400 irrigation schemes constructed benefiting 1 million population
✅132 individual and 5 community housing
✅ 1615 Trail Bridges constructed benefitting 10 million population (technical support)
✅ 1,242 km of rural roads constructed
✅536 km Foot Trails constructed
✅12 School Buildings constructed
✅ 9 Healthcare Facilities constructed
